Description
|
STRO-1 is a cell surface antigen recognized by mAb STRO-1. It is expressed by bone marrow mesenchymal stromalcells and nucleated erythroid precursors, but not by committed hematopoietic progenitors. In combination withglycophorin A (GPA), STRO-1 is a useful marker for identification of mesenchymal stem cells. It has been reportedthat STRO-1+/GPA- bone marrow cell subset can be used as a universal stromal feeder layer for hematopoieticstem/progenitor cells. This subset of cells has multipotent to differentiate into fibroblasts, adipocytes, osteoblasts,chondrocytes, and vascular smooth muscle-like cells.

Application Notes
|
Each lot of this antibody is quality control tested by immunofluorescentstaining with flow cytometric analysis. For immunofluorescent staining, thesuggested use of this reagent is 20 ul per 106 cells in 100 ul volume or 100 ulof whole blood. It is recommended that the reagent be titrated for optimalperformance for each application.
